Minutes — Management Meeting, Dravik Instruments

Attendees: M. Solenne (chair), P. Arkwell, T. Vane. Topic: retirement of the Fenwick gauge line. Decision: production ends Q3; spares support continues 18 months. Arkwell to notify distributors in Kellborn and Osthaven. Vane owns inventory drawdown plan, due in two weeks. Remaining tooling to be scrapped or sold. Incoming director briefed separately on staffing impact. Strategic context for this retirement is recorded in the confidential note below.

internal memo for kawip-hadug: Headcount on the Wenwyn team goes from 7 to 140 by the end of January. Gross margin on Wenwyn came in at 20 percent against a plan of 15 percent.

Internal Memo — Project Lanthorn Delay

To the finance team: Project Lanthorn, our warehouse automation upgrade at the Creswick site, is now delayed by eight weeks due to late delivery of conveyor modules from Ferrovale Systems. Budget impact is estimated at a 4% overrun, absorbed within contingency. Revised milestones will be circulated once vendor commitments are confirmed. The confidential planning note from the steering group appears below.

board note of kageg-bahof: The renewal with Holwynax Holdings closes at $2 million a year, 5 percent below the last contract. Project Ulaath slips by two quarters because of the supplier delay.

# Break-Glass: Catalog Cache Invalidation

Scope: the Pinrow product catalog at Veldstone Retail. If stale prices persist after a purge and the Hollowmere invalidation queue is wedged, use break-glass to flush the edge tier directly. Contractors: get verbal sign-off from the catalog lead first. Steps: open the Hollowmere admin shell, select emergency-flush, confirm the tenant, and run it once — repeated flushes thrash the origin. Access is logged and expires after 20 minutes. Unseal the admin shell with the passphrase below.

recovery phrase for kahop-tajog: istix-casvan